If the revamped décor doesn't convince you that things have changed, maybe the menu's quinoa pancake with fig marmalade will. The remaining dining rooms have been reconfigured, and while some bricks, wood, and chandeliers remain, the entire space is lightened and brightened to invigorating effect. The library room, for instance, appears as though it's been soaked in a gargantuan vat of bleach it still has the same book-lined shelves and stained-glass windows, but now they jump out from a white palette rather than melt into a musty, old brown one. By the time it closed its doors for a $10 million renovation last year, the Forge's museum-like mahogany interior seemed antiquated - and its clientele wasn't getting any younger either. It debuted in 1969, and as the fortunes of Miami Beach have shifted like sand over the decades, so too has the reputation of this iconic steak house. The Forge is as famous as any South Florida restaurant not named Joe's Stone Crab.
